| // Copyright (c) 2013-2015 The btcsuite developers
 | |
| // Use of this source code is governed by an ISC
 | |
| // license that can be found in the LICENSE file.
 | |
| 
 | |
| package wire
 | |
| 
 | |
| import (
 | |
| 	"io"
 | |
| )
 | |
| 
 | |
| // MsgPing implements the Message interface and represents a bitcoin ping
 | |
| // message.
 | |
| //
 | |
| // For versions BIP0031Version and earlier, it is used primarily to confirm
 | |
| // that a connection is still valid.  A transmission error is typically
 | |
| // interpreted as a closed connection and that the peer should be removed.
 | |
| // For versions AFTER BIP0031Version it contains an identifier which can be
 | |
| // returned in the pong message to determine network timing.
 | |
| //
 | |
| // The payload for this message just consists of a nonce used for identifying
 | |
| // it later.
 | |
| type MsgPing struct {
 | |
| 	// Unique value associated with message that is used to identify
 | |
| 	// specific ping message.
 | |
| 	Nonce uint64
 | |
| }
 | |
| 
 | |
| // BtcDecode decodes r using the bitcoin protocol encoding into the receiver.
 | |
| // This is part of the Message interface implementation.
 | |
| func (msg *MsgPing) BtcDecode(r io.Reader, pver uint32) error {
 | |
| 	err := ReadElement(r, &msg.Nonce)
 | |
| 	if err != nil {
 | |
| 		return err
 | |
| 	}
 | |
| 
 | |
| 	return nil
 | |
| }
 | |
| 
 | |
| // BtcEncode encodes the receiver to w using the bitcoin protocol encoding.
 | |
| // This is part of the Message interface implementation.
 | |
| func (msg *MsgPing) BtcEncode(w io.Writer, pver uint32) error {
 | |
| 	err := WriteElement(w, msg.Nonce)
 | |
| 	if err != nil {
 | |
| 		return err
 | |
| 	}
 | |
| 
 | |
| 	return nil
 | |
| }
 | |
| 
 | |
| // Command returns the protocol command string for the message.  This is part
 | |
| // of the Message interface implementation.
 | |
| func (msg *MsgPing) Command() string {
 | |
| 	return CmdPing
 | |
| }
 | |
| 
 | |
| // MaxPayloadLength returns the maximum length the payload can be for the
 | |
| // receiver.  This is part of the Message interface implementation.
 | |
| func (msg *MsgPing) MaxPayloadLength(pver uint32) uint32 {
 | |
| 	// Nonce 8 bytes.
 | |
| 	return uint32(8)
 | |
| }
 | |
| 
 | |
| // NewMsgPing returns a new bitcoin ping message that conforms to the Message
 | |
| // interface.  See MsgPing for details.
 | |
| func NewMsgPing(nonce uint64) *MsgPing {
 | |
| 	return &MsgPing{
 | |
| 		Nonce: nonce,
 | |
| 	}
 | |
| }
